WebDec 23, 2015 · Small or medium-sized enterprise ( SME) R&D tax relief allows companies to: deduct an extra 130% of their qualifying costs from their yearly profit, as well as the … WebApr 10, 2024 · R&D RELIEF RATE CHANGES. For SME R&D relief, HMRC are lowering the additional deduction from 130% to 86% and reducing the credit rate from 14.5% to 10%. For R&D Expenditure Credit (RDEC), the rate will rise from 13% to 20%. As a result, the benefit on expenditure incurred on or after 1 April 2024 will be 15% (up from 10.53%).

WebJan 26, 2024 · Research and Development: Tax Deduction Changes for Businesses. Starting January 1, 2024, taxpayers will no longer be allowed to deduct R&D Section 174 expenses in the year incurred. Businesses will be required to capitalize R&D costs for tax purposes as an intangible asset and amortize over a 5 or 15-year period depending on associated ...
